NettetAluminum cans are the most recycled drink container in the United States. In 2013, 1.72 billion lbs., roughly 60.2 billion cans were recycled. That is a recycling rate of nearly 70%. The energy saved by this kind of recycling equals roughly 19 million barrels of crude oil. Nettet15. nov. 2024 · November 15, 2024. NettetRecycling Statistics 64% materials at JCCC were kept out of the landfill, a process known as waste division. $273,090 has been earned from recycling revenue since 1994. JCCC saved $205,785 between 2010 and 2024 by reducing the amount of trash hauled.
